There's nothing you can do to prevent fallen particles from entering into your gutters. However, you can ensure your gutters working condition by cleaning it and eliminating all those undesirable materials. Here's a couple of basic concepts on the best ways to make your gutters clean. Initially, get rid of the debris that can trigger your rain gutters to clog up. You will need a protected ladder to reach the rain gutters and perform this job. As soon as the rain gutters are cleared of debris, wash the rain gutters off with water. For this you can use your garden tube.
If you have a rain gutter cleansing wand, you can connect this to your pipe to create a high pressure stream of water. Next, get hard-bristled brush, ideally one with a long deal with, and start brushing the floorings and the sides of your gutters. Round off your cleansing by flushing water once again to wash off all staying dirt. Remember, to accomplish all the above, you need to prepare the best rain gutter cleaning tools to assist you be successful.
While you were cleaning up, did you discover any wear and tear in your gutters? Did you find any issue with the draining pipes system? Did you see any breaks in the accessories that hold your rain gutters in place? If you did, get these breaks repaired instantly to prevent worse issues in the future. By being extensive and organized in your work, you can do a very good job of keeping your rain gutters tidy and well preserved.

Gutter upkeep and cleansing
Gutter systems must preferably be cleaned thoroughly in spring and fall but at the very least rain gutters need to be inspected before winter. This is to prevent trapped particles and water from freezing in the colder weather condition putting additional strain on the system.
Certainly should the residential or commercial property or building lie near trees more regular cleansing might be needed as blockage could form more quickly.
It is also important to bear in mind that although a regular cleaning regimen can quickly avoid any problems noted above the job of cleansing gutter has to be undertaken with caution as with any work from height.
Falls are the most typical cause of fatal injury so if the property is higher than single story or roofing gain access to is hard, it is strongly advised to employ a totally trained and effectively geared up professional.
Should access not show hard, ensure that you are using a durable ladder and lean it up against a solid surface area. Never ever lean the ladder versus the rain gutter system as the latter is probably to give in the weight.
Once you can reach your rain gutters you will require some kind of rain gutter cleaning tools to clear out the debris, the most basic and most budget-friendly of all being a humble pair of gloves.
After removing any caught debris and scrubbed the inside of your rain gutters to get rid of any residues, wash your gutters thoroughly using your garden tube to conclude the cleansing of your gutters.

Why is it so essential to keep gutters clean? Blocked gutters can wreak havoc on your house and residential or commercial property in a number of various ways:
Block water overflow - Most importantly, rain gutters must remain clear merely because clogged rain gutters cannot correctly drain water far from your house's exterior and foundation. When backed-up water enters into your house's infrastructure, it will eventually corrode the walls, structure and basement floors, causing costly structural damage.
Gutter Deterioration - As debris develops in your gutters, it forms a destructive sludge-like material that can actually eat away at the material that comprises your rain gutters. This will ultimately damage and harm gutters, hindering their ability to drain water correctly. As water develops to the point where it overflows the side your gutters, you can expect the filthy sludge to overflow also, causing unsightly spots on your rain gutter's exterior and the sides of your house.
Preventing Ice Dams - Regularly cleaning up gutters in fall will pay off well into winter when those nasty snow storms - called "snowmageddon" in the Northeast - discard mounds of snow on your roofing system. Even before the temperature level rises back above freezing, the snow begins to melt from the heat originating from your house. This heat will melt the snow from the bottom up, sending sheets of thin down to your rain gutters. Clogged rain gutters will prevent this water from draining. Instead, the overflow freezes, creating harmful overflows of ice called ice dams. Icicles formed from ice dams may be nice to look at, but the extra weight puts incredible pressure on your rain gutters, triggering them to pull away from the home and in some cases entirely break off, ripping away the facia board and causing damage beyond repair.
